Base Game & Features
The game operates on a 5×3 grid with 25 fixed paylines–all active on every spin. This straightforward structure keeps the ruleset approachable, though the feature mechanics running underneath add considerable texture to base gameplay. You’re constantly tracking three distinct metres simultaneously: the blue piggy bank, yellow piggy bank, and red piggy bank. Each accumulates coloured coins, and each tells a different story about where the session is heading.

The base game is anchored by two key mechanics that show Light & Wonder’s attention to detail. Mystery Symbols land as question marks and transform into any regular symbol, wild symbol, or coloured coin. They often fill entire reels, creating cascading transformations that boost win chances significantly. You’ll frequently see multiple mystery symbols transform into matching symbols on the same spin, which creates satisfying visual moments and genuine mechanical value. Stacked Wilds appear single or across full reels, creating additional win combinations throughout the grid. These work together to add meaningful volatility to base spins–neither feature feels vestigial.
Speaking of volatility, Rich Little Piggies Meal Ticket sits in the medium range with a 10.27% hit frequency, meaning wins land roughly once every ten spins. This steady stream of rewards keeps sessions flowing, though the distribution remains uneven–some spins return 2x stake, others 50x, creating that characteristic medium volatility rhythm. The RTP stands at 95.97% (note: multiple versions exist ranging 90% to 95.97%, with 95.97% most common in UK casinos).
Bonus Features & Free Spins
The bonus structure defines this slot’s identity, and it’s where design philosophy becomes apparent. Rather than a single dominant free spins mode, Light & Wonder created three independent paths, each triggered by coloured coins and delivering distinct experiences. This architecture is genuinely unusual in modern slots–most releases converge features toward a single mega-bonus. Here, you’re juggling three simultaneous metres.

Blue Piggy Free Spins trigger when you’ve collected enough blue coins (starting at 9 spins, increasing by accumulating additional coins to a theoretical maximum of 100). Blue coins arrive from mystery symbol transformations, making this feature accessible relatively frequently. The upside: free spins range from 7 to 100 depending on accumulation. The reality check: players report that consistent profitability requires hitting at least 18 coins, which happens far less frequently than the base trigger threshold. Sessions flow better when blue metres build gradually–single triggers often disappoint.
Yellow Piggy Free Spins unlock a six-tier jackpot system with multipliers spanning 0.25x (Mini) through 6.75x (Mega). This feature delivers seven base free spins if triggered independently, but the real draw is the hierarchical jackpot unlock. The mechanics here generate genuine excitement–watching which tier you’ll hit carries anticipation. However, community feedback reveals that completing jackpot metres proves exasperatingly difficult; you’ll frequently see metres nearly full, only for final coins to remain stubbornly elusive across extended sessions.
Red Piggy Free Spins add wild symbols to the play area rather than removing symbols as sometimes reported. The red metre starts at 15 additional wilds, increasing by 15 for each non-triggering red coin collected. This feature creates tangible base game improvements during the free spins round–the additional wild coverage genuinely improves win frequency compared to standard play.
What makes Rich Little Piggies Meal Ticket mechanically distinctive is multiple simultaneous triggering. You can land blue, yellow, and red piggy bonuses on the same spin, combining their effects for enhanced rewards. This simultaneous triggering introduces genuine variance–landing all three creates sessions that feel fundamentally different from single-trigger rounds. Community discussion acknowledges this mechanic directly: advantage players note that hitting multiple bonuses simultaneously becomes necessary for profitability, which happens rarely enough to create meaningful variance.
The betting range spans £0.20 to £24 per spin, accommodating diverse budgets. Maximum win sits at 12,500x via the Mega Jackpot (secondary sources cite 12,917x as theoretically possible through additional bonus multipliers, though 12,500x represents the primary stated maximum). The maximum single win of 12,500x ranks among the highest possible payouts in modern slots, though community consensus emphasises that such wins require extreme conditions: all three pigs triggering simultaneously combined with jackpot metres hitting maximum tiers.
Our Honest Verdict
Rich Little Piggies Meal Ticket succeeds brilliantly in one dimension and reveals limitations in another. Light & Wonder’s decision to favour mechanical variety over a single dominant feature creates gameplay that avoids the repetition trap–sessions genuinely feel different when different metres trigger. The charming farmyard aesthetic remains one of the slot’s genuine strengths; player feedback universally praises the cartoon presentation, vibrant piggy characters, and thematic consistency. The game carries a classic feel that appeals to traditional slot enthusiasts whilst the colourful design attracts casual players. Three separate free spins features prevent boredom from waiting for the same bonus repeatedly.
Where Rich Little Piggies Meal Ticket frustrates players is in bonus mechanics and win realism. Coin collection metres become exasperatingly difficult to complete despite favourable conditions–you’ll frequently see metres nearly full across extended sessions whilst final coins refuse to materialise. Single bonus triggers consistently disappoint with minimal returns; only when multiple features trigger simultaneously does genuine value emerge. This design philosophy creates a bifurcated experience: casual players chasing variety find appeal in the three-feature approach, whilst those seeking profitability face a harsh mathematical reality. Advantage players disagree sharply on volatility assessment, with consensus centering on the requirement for simultaneous multi-feature triggers to overcome house edge meaningfully.
The game divides players along skill and experience lines. Traditional slot enthusiasts appreciate the straightforward mechanics, varied features, and farmyard charm. Players willing to track metre states find variable-state opportunities when conditions align. Casual players enjoy the cheerful presentation and feature variety that keeps sessions engaging. Those seeking consistent base game action or realistic expectations around maximum win potential should look elsewhere–this game requires patience, specific trigger conditions, and comfort with extended dry spells.
Overall Rating: 7/10 – Rich Little Piggies Meal Ticket delivers entertaining farmyard-themed gameplay with mechanically sound features, supported by a competitive 95.97% RTP and medium volatility profile. The three-pig approach creates engaging variety that prevents monotony. However, difficult metre completion mechanics, single-feature disappointment, and realistic win distribution requiring extreme trigger combinations limit broader appeal. It will more than suffice for players appreciating theme-driven gameplay and mechanical variety, though those seeking straightforward value or massive win potential should evaluate expectations carefully.
